Call and ask for the editor of the Opinion section, and ask what the procedure is for submitting a piece.
You will probably have to modify it some, to fit their format.
Otherwise, you can always submit a Letter to the Editor; but I'm guessing your piece is too long for that. But if you do, be sure to leave a phone number where they can reach you in the late afternoon, which is usually when they will call you up to ask your permission to print it.
